Geophysical Imaging Scan System
This system relies on soil electrical resistivity analysis to accurately visualize subsurface layers.
It provides 3D images illustrating the extent, density, and type of water sources (fresh, saline, or mineral).
The new interface, updated for 2026, displays data in a gradient color spectrum reflecting salinity and density levels.
Projects and readings can be saved internally for later review.

Manual Geophysical Scan System
Full control over depth, distance, sensitivity, and number of points.
Suitable for specialized engineers conducting customized field measurements.
Can identify the type of water (fresh, saline, mineral) based on potential and resistivity.
